![]() ![]() You need to do is wrap the Dialog in a, and dialog will transition automaticallyīased on the state of the show prop on the. To animate the opening/closing of the dialog, use the Transition component. So, when using our Dialog, there's no need to use a Portal yourself! Embed & implement Lottie animations in design tools. This way we can provide features like unobstructed event handling and making the Simplify and speed up your motion design workflow with a range of LottieFiles. ![]() Makes it easy to apply scroll locking to the rest of your application, as well as ensure that yourĭialog's contents and backdrop are unobstructed to receive focus and click events.īecause of these accessibility concerns, Headless UI's Dialog component actually uses a Portal Ordering to ensure that their content is rendered on top of your existing application UI. There are some out-of-the-box features or selling points: Animations ( CodeSandbox demo) Variants. It utilizes the power of the Framer prototyping tool and is fully open-source. Complete documentation of the Framer Motion animation library. Sibling to the root-most node of your React application. Framer Motion is a production-ready motion library for React. An open source, production-ready motion library for React on the web. Since Dialogs and their backdrops take up the full page, you typically want to render them as a Consequently, you do not need to write extra. See why Framer Motion is the best React animation library. ![]() Try Framer for free Features Explore the latest features. The team has built a separate motion component for every HTML element. Designers who prototype in Framer can leverage the power of Framer Motion without touching a line of code, then handoff the animation values to be used 1:1 in production. One place in the DOM (for instance deep within your application UI), but actually render to another Motion components are the core of Framer. If you've ever implemented a Dialog before, you've probably come across It lays the foundation for all aspects of modern motion design and covers every topic from AE basics to character rigging, frame by frame animation in Animate.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|